Settler's Moon
Sweet smoke curling
'round the camp
huddled in the cold and damp
fireside lovers
cuddle dearer
wolves howl somewhere
closer,nearer
circled wagons strong embrace
around the buckskin
and the lace
around the children
of the plains
brave thou cold and wind
and rain
there to find the dream within
to go where no one else
has been.
beneath the chalice of the sky,
the settler's moon
and you and I.
